Official vacheron overseas thread!!




Here’s my blue recently acquired. I have owned Patek (4) AP (3 including a jumbo perpetual) and A Lange, it is my first VC.

Over the years I have developed certain criteria and tendencies. I live in a very hot climate so that rules out crocodile or leather straps. I get tired of changing these very expensive things every six months. While I have had almost every complication under the sun The expense on maintaining them outweighs their usefulness for most of the time.

This thing really ticks a lot of boxes. Easily interchangeable straps system, 150 m water resistance and the Geneva Steel. It is not a petite watch (I have a 19 cm wrist) it is certainly not big or bulky. Very appropriate for the time.

There is actually quite a shortage of these right now. Maybe VC finally caught on and started limiting supply but if you go out and look for them there are almost none anywhere.

While it is designed to compete with the Royal Oak and Nautilus, these watches feel delicate in comparison. I think it is the haute horological Rolex Datejust 41.
